Note: Genealogy is the atvdy of one’s family history-the tracing of a person’s ancestors. Beginning Uist week, Mrs. Janis W. Cannon will focus on the history of families in the Vanceboro area using old photos, diaries, letters and other memorabilia of the vast loaned by area residents. Mrs. Cannon welcomes anyone who has information or items of this kind and who wishes to loan it for use in this column, to bring the items to Cannon’s Variety Store in Vanceboro or mail it to “Genealogically Speaking, ’’c/o Mrs. Janis W. Cannon, P. 0. Box S77, Vanceboro,^.C. 28586. * THIS WEEK: We focus on education. School teachers of the early 1800’s had a quite different educational system. One Turner Nelson who lived in Northern Craven County near the Craven, Pitt and Beaufort County lines had the following contract. Dated July 20, 1823. Found in Roach Family Papers in East Carolina University Library. “These articles of agreement made between Turner Nelson as teacher of W.Cannon reading, writing, and arithmetic and the undersigned as Employers. The said Nelson doth obligate to teach reading, writing and arithmetic in the School House near Piney Grove Mill for the term of six months for and in/consideration of the sum of Six Dollars to me in hand paid by the Subscribers for each and every achollar, signed opposite our respective names three dollars to be paid at the expiration of three months for every schollar and die other three in the expiration of six months and the said Nelson to board himself." Mrs. Colie Miller loves her blueberry bushes and so do her neighbors. She says about twenty bushels of blueberries have been picked from the seven bushes her husband planted about ten years ago. Mrs. Miller lets neighbors or anyone pick the berries. “This has been an abundant year for blueberries due to the rain.
